#9 – Boeing Vertol CH-46 Sea Knight

Max Takeoff Weight: 24,300 lbs
Empty Weight: 15,500 lbs

If helicopters had a class reunion, the CH-46 would be the humble hero who doesn’t brag, but everyone knows they saved lives. With a design featuring tandem rotors (because one just wasn’t enough), the Sea Knight has been a staple of U.S. military missions since Vietnam.

It might be retired now, but during its glory days, this twin-engine beauty flew Marines into battle, evacuated wounded soldiers, and carried everything from supplies to…well, more Marines.
